stagione
English
Noun
stagione (uncountable)
- A system for presenting opera, whereby each production is cast separately and has a brief but intensive run of performances.

Italian
Etymology
From Latin stātiōnem, the accusative singular of stātiō. Cognate to stazione which is from the same Latin word but borrowed instead of inherited. Also a doublet of stazzo and stazzone.
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/staˈd͡ʒo.ne/, [s̪t̪äˈd͡ʒo̞ːn̺e]
- Hyphenation: sta‧gió‧ne
Noun
stagione f (plural stagioni)
- season (quarter of a year, part of year with something special)
- (broadcasting) season (group of episodes)
- weather
- la stagione calda ― hot weather
